Fired MSP detective Michael Proctor no-show in court

Former homicide detective Michael Proctor who was fired for misconduct in the Karen Read occurrence was a no-show in court for a separate situation Defense attorneys disclosed Proctor was subpoenaed for a hearing the day before about several cases he was involved with including a murder in Milton His lawyer disclosed Proctor is on a pre-planned vacation The defense wants the situation dismissed because of Proctor s involvement and delays in getting search warrants form the Norfolk DA The next hearing is scheduled for August Proctor s lawyer reported he will be there
